Keyword Related SEO Interview questions

Q1. What are a keyword and its role in SEO?

A keyword is a focus word or phrase that describes the content on your page. It is important for SEO professionals because a search based on keywords gives a fair idea of what people want. Therefore, a keyword is a term you search often so that it ranks with a specific page. In this one of the basic SEO Interview questions, interviewer expects to know the role of keywords which businesses can aim for any information, product, service, etc.

Q2. What is keyword frequency?

The number of times a keyword is used within the content is called Keyword Frequency. It is essential to limit the addition of keywords in the content. Otherwise, when optimizing the page, the search engine will put the content to the point of keyword stuffing or spamming.

Q3. What is the keyword Proximity?

Keyword Proximity represents the distance or nearness of words/phrases from each other in a piece of content. For example:

  1. Henry Harvin’s Digital Marketing Course is excellent. I love the institute.
  2. It’s great to do Digital Marketing Course. I love Henry Harvin institute.

If someone searches for the ‘Henry Harvin digital marketing course’ on Google, the chance of the first result is higher in contrast to the second. Therefore, in the first sentence, the keyword proximity is higher.

Q4. Explain Keyword Density.

Keyword Density is the proportion of times a keyword or phrase occurs on a specific web page. If the keyword density is far more than the optimal level, it might trigger search engine crawlers to consider it as keyword stuffing. Although there is no perfect keyword density, 3–4% is recommended as the best practice for SEO. In this SEO Interview question, Keyword Density Formula is following:

Keyword Density = (No. of times a keyword / total count of keywords) * 100

Q5. What does a good keyword difficulty score tell you?

The keyword difficulty score ranges between 1 to 100.

  • The range of low keyword difficulty scores lies between 1 to 29
  • Medium keyword difficulty score ranges between 30 to 70
  • The range between 70-100 is a high keyword difficulty score.

The score of keyword difficulty is based on the number of websites targeting similar keywords to rank it on Google. For a high authority website with quality content and high traffic, we can go with the keywords that have high keyword difficulty. On the other hand, for a new website with low authority, it is advisable to use low or medium difficulty. Therefore, it would be better to use keywords that can be ranked easily. Eventually, we can build the authority and then go for higher-difficulty keywords. 

Q6. What is meant by keyword stemming?

Keyword stemming is a method of finding new keywords from the main keyword in the search query. And then building new keywords by joining suffixes, prefixes, and pluralization. Thus, the ability of the Google algorithm to understand the context of the page and match it with relevant keywords makes a page more searchable.

 

Other Basic terminologies asked in SEO Interview Questions

Q7. What is the bounce rate and how does it affect SEO?

The bounce rate depicts the percentage of visitors leaving the site without any action. This means visitors are not satisfied with the content, user experience, speed, or other things of a site. Since SEO is all about user experience, thus reduced bounce rate is a success factor for any website. The formula to calculate the bounce rate is:

Bounce Rate = (No. of site visitors leaving without action/total no. of visited pages) * 100

Q8. What is the exit rate and difference from the bounce rate?

The exit rate in SEO is when a user comes to a specific page and then goes to next or next and so on, and finally leaves it. The exit rate is calculated when the user leaves the website from a certain page.

Q9. What is search engine submission?

Search engine submission refers to the method of listing the website with search engines so that it gets crawled and indexed. Below are the following two methods:

  1. Submission of one page at a time with the help of a webmaster tool.
  2. Submitting the entire site to as many search engines as you want. Also, called a mass submission process. 

Q10. What is directory submission?

Directory submission is a process of seeding the website URL to various web directories just to get backlinks thus increasing business growth. You can present your website to a niche-relevant directory where searchers look for businesses.

Q11. What is a press release submission in SEO?

Press release submission on websites is writing newsworthy content, press releases, new events, company’s products or services etc. Thus, these platforms serve as sources of news and announcements for journalists and reporters ensuring the content is engaging and meaningful.

Q12. What do you mean by TLD?

TLD stands for Top-level domain. It is the concluding part of an internet address or the part of a domain that comes after the dot. For example, .com, .org, or .net, etc.

 

Q13. What do you mean by ccTLD?

ccTLD is an acronym for country code Top-Level. These domain names have targeted customers in a particular country. For instance, .in for India, .us for the United States etc. So, for businesses in India and the targeted customers in the US, ccTLD can convey to Google that the searchers belong to the US. Therefore, can help in international SEO if used the right way.

Q14. What is Google My Business?

Google My Business is a service for listing businesses on the google search engine to gain more visibility. Therefore, adding business information, pictures, responses to customers and google reviews works as an effective SEO and lead-generation tool.

Q15. What do you mean by Keyword Prominence?

Keyword Prominence is the process of using a primary keyword of the content within the initial part of a web page. The main keyword should appear within the first 100 words of the page. Eventually, the keyword prominence in content helps in search engine optimization.

 Q16. Define Spiders, Robots and Crawlers

Spiders, robots, and crawlers are software programs that explore the internet and then grab the content from websites and index the web pages.

Q17. What is a Domain Authority?

Domain Authority is one of the ranking factors that define the authority of your entire website. Therefore, the ability of a page to rank better increases with high Domain Authority. MOZ has developed Domain Authority for the Page ranking algorithm.

Q18. What is HTTPS?

Hypertext transfer protocol secure (HTTPS) encrypts all the data for secured communication on the world wide web. The data is transferred in a combination of non-secured HTTP protocol with a Secure Socket Layer (SSL)/ Transport Layer Socket (TLS). Hence, the HTTPS connection offers benefits like data integrity, website authentication and data encryption.

Q19. Mention the difference between long-tail and short-tail keywords.

Long-tail keywords contain more than three words which make searches highly specific. Therefore, these have relatively low search volume, but also low competition. Whereas, short-tail keywords have one or two words. For this reason, these keywords have high volume but high competition as well. Thus, long-tail keywords in SEO help to build some traffic for a new or low-authority website in comparison to short-tail keywords.

 

Q20. What are canonical issues?

A canonical issue happens when there is the same content with duplicate links.  For this reason, Google penalizes such duplicate content. Therefore, more than one URL with identical content can be fixed by adding 301 redirecting or canonical tagging to the websites.

Q21. What is Image Alt Text in SEO?

An image alt tag describes an image on a web page that can be read by search engines. Therefore, images should also be optimized using alt text to impact a page’s ranking.

 

Q22. What is a Page Ranking?

PageRank is one of the algorithms used by Google which includes both organic search and paid results. These page ranking measures the performance of the webpage and are not just random positions.

Q23. Define Googlebot.

Googlebot is a web crawler software to search and indexes web pages. The two types of  Googlebot crawlers are desktop and mobile crawlers.

 

Q24. What is off-page optimization?

Off-page optimization focuses on the page ranking factors that happen outside your website. It aims to increase the authority of your domain by getting links from other websites. Some of the most important off-page ranking factors are backlinks, blogging, social media engagement, etc.

Q25. What is on-page optimization?

On-page optimization refers to optimizing different parts of your website to improve and earn organic search engine rankings. The main factors of On-page SEO that help a site to rank are title tags, keywords-based content optimization, page speed, URL Speed, meta description, image alt tags optimization, internal linking, etc.

 

Q26. What does 301 redirect mean?

The user and crawlers are redirected from an old URL to a new URL using this method. Google moves the page permanently and then indexes the new page. 301 redirects used in specific areas are the following:

  • URL change.
  • Content creation.
  • Migration of content to the other domain.

Q27. What is 302 redirect?

It is a method for temporary redirection for a particular period. Therefore, Google will not remove the previous URL page from indexing.

Page Ranking Related SEO Interview Questions

Q28. How is Page Rank different from SERP?

A search Engine Result Page (SERP) is the list of pages displayed when a user searches for something on a search engine. The search results may be a result of sponsored Ads, organic searches or related searches. Page rank is based on the quality of inbound links from other websites.

Q29. Describe Google’s Rich Answer Box.

Google’s Rich Answer Box is a way of assisting users to see the search result without clicking the link on any website.  They are not part of SEO but will get more traffic from the search results. Thus, the rich snippet refers to the featured text at the top of the search results page organically.

Q30. What is an SSL Certificate and how it is a ranking factor?

SSL stands for Secure Sockets Layer, a digital certificate that secures and encrypts the information submitted by users on a website. This information further travels from the browser to the website server. If an SSL certificate is not added, this means that data can be compromised to keep customer information secured. Since SSL certificates can hamper the user experience if intercepted by hackers. For this reason, it is also considered a ranking factor.

Q31.  What is Panda update and its key aspects?

Google Panda update is a search filter that lowers the rank of “low-quality sites”. Similarly, high-quality sites are seen at the top of the search results. Thus, the focus of this Panda update is to reward websites with high-quality content, proper design and good speed.

Q32. What is the Penguin update and its key aspects?

The Penguin update was launched to decrease the ranking of those websites that are violating the Google Webmaster guidelines. Its main target is to reward good websites for their quality. While penalising the sites that are manipulated using link farms, spammed backlinks, cloaking and keyword stuffing, etc.

Q33. What is Google Hummingbird update?

Hummingbird is the biggest google update to its algorithm. The unique ability of the update is to read the intent of keywords rather than just keywords. Indeed, the Hummingbird is a total redesign that provides searchers with precise and more accurate results.

Q34. What is the meaning of Cloaking?

Cloaking is a deceptive way of optimizing your website where the user receives different content or URLs in contrast to search engine crawlers. Consequently, the user lands on low-quality pages that don’t answer the questions we were asking. Thus, cloaking also known as a black-hat SEO practice is a mix of indexing and spamming that tries to fool a search engine.

Q35. Which tool is used to remove toxic links to a site?

A Backlink quality checker tool can be used to find out toxic links to the site. Further, Disavow Tool is a Google Search Console tool to remove these harmful links. The disavow eases the websites after link auditing or when it loses rank but still, the tool should be managed very precisely.

Q36. Explain the differences between SEO and SEM.

Search Engine Optimisation (SEO) is the process of improving the visibility of a website through unpaid forms of advertisement. It is inexpensive and suitable for low-budget companies. Thus, it helps to increase the traffic potential of a website. For example, Backlinks creation. Whereas, Search Engine Marketing (SEM) is the process of improving the visibility of a website through paid advertisements. It is expensive and suitable for big-budget companies. Examples of SEM are Adsense, Pay per click, Adwords, and so on.

Optimization Techniques Related SEO Interview Questions

Q37. Describe NAP.

Name, Address, and Phone Number(NAP) is important for businesses that want to rank well in the local organic search results. The search engines identify these list of companies for geo-targeted searches. 

Q38. Explain AMP.

AMP is an acronym for Accelerated Mobile Pages, an open-source web framework to manage the readability and speed of pages on mobile devices. And makes possible to load simple mobile websites almost immediately for a better user experience.

 

Q39. What is the meaning of the Sandbox effect?

Google sandbox is an imaginary area where new websites and their search rating are put on hold until they prove worthy of ranking. In other words, even if a website qualifies for all the SEO factors, the website will not be ranked for a few months. Thus, it checks the standard of the website before a ranking can commence.

 

Q40. How does robots.txt work?

A robots.txt is a file that a search engine bot reads and further instructs the crawlers about how to crawl and index the website and its pages. Generally, this is the first file on the site to manage crawler traffic to the website. Hence, the role of the robot.txt file is to avoid unnecessary visits by search engine bots on the websites.

 

Q41. What is the advantage of Meta Robot tags over robots.txt?

A robots.txt file is a part of the robot exclusion protocol that gives instructions to crawlers about the entire site Meta tags, also known as meta robots directives are HTML code snippets. They instruct search engine crawlers on which pages to crawl and index on your website. Generally, the meta tags are snippets added to the head section of a web page. However, unlike robot.txt, they cannot prevent image, video and audio files from appearing in search results.

Q42. What is RSS Feed?

Really Simple Syndication (RSS) is the method that updates information automatically into an easy-to-read format, XML files. Thus, content is distributed in real-time so that the latest published content for a website ranks at the top.

Q43. Describe Forum posting.

Forum posting is an off-page SEO technique where you build a profile to participate in online discussion forums. Also, respond to different questions to divert traffic to your site. Thus, it ultimately helps to reach out to potential users and engage them. 

 

Q44. What is the meaning of article spinning?

This is one of the important SEO interview questions to measure your expertise. Article spinning is a black hat SEO technique used to write content that appears to be new. Thus, creating an illusion with low quality and repetitive content as if original article.

Q45. What is a doorway page?

A doorway page is a black hat method, created for spamdexing. It has invisible text that search engines could read but users couldn’t. Thus, the page is optimized to rank well in search results and then tricked to automatically redirect to the actual landing page, once the user hits the page.

Page Optimization Analysis Related SEO Interview Questions

Q46. What are the ways to decrease the loading time of the website?

In these type of SEO interview questions, the interviewer expects you to know all the possible ways to decrease the loading time of the website. Hence, following are the ways to achieve it.

  •       Optimizing the Images.
  •       Optimize through content writing.
  •       Reduce 301 redirects.
  •       Scale down the size of the images.
  •       Put style sheet references to the<head>
  •       Minification of HTML, JavaScript and CSS files.
  •       Enable browser cache.
  •       Enable compression to reduce the bandwidth of pages.

Q47. What is the role of Schema?

Schema is structured data which uses unique semantic vocabulary. Although search engines are powerful tools that use algorithms. But they still need help reading, identifying and categorising the content of web pages. Therefore, schema markup is a language that search engines can understand to read the content of the pages.

Q48. What is the role of Google Search Console?

Google Search Console is a free service to maintain and evaluate the performance of a website in search results. Additionally, it also helps you monitor, and fix errors. On the whole, it is also called the Google Webmaster tool that helps understand and optimize the website better.

SEM Related SEO Interview Questions

Q49. What does PPC mean?

Pay per click or PPC is an advertisement campaign in which you pay a fee to rank your website on the search engine result page. When someone types specific keywords or phrases, the search engine display the ads created for the visitors and you pay price only when the user clicks on the ad.

Q50.What are Google Ads and how does it work?

PPC uses Google Ads as the most commonly used advertising system. It works on a bidding system on a set of keywords to appear on search results. Therefore, optimize quality score and bid amount should be optimized for better ad positioning from Google AdWords.

 Q51. What does CTR mean?

Click Through Rate abbreviated as CTR is an important metric to measure the success of site optimisation. To calculate this, divide the number of impressions by the number of clicks. Sometimes keywords are ranking but still, significant traffic is not coming. Thus, it means the CTR score is poor. Therefore, improving the score optimisation of meta titles and descriptions is important.

Q52. Explain E-A-T and its importance in SEO.

Expertise, authoritativeness and trustworthiness, an acronym for E-A-T is a principle under the Search Quality Raters Guidelines by Google. Quality raters are real people to determine the quality and effectiveness of search results. Therefore, Google search results should meet the needs of users based on the Search Quality Rater Guidelines. To enumerate, Google does not give E-A-T score to the website. However, following E-A-T, guides, Google engineers improvise algorithms to adjust rankings in search engines. This one of the important SEO interview questions is asked to both intermediates and experts in the digital marketing field.

 

Top SEO Interview Questions

Q53. What is the importance of Dwell Time in SEO?

This is one of the top SEO Interview questions. Dwell time is the amount of time a user stays on a page before clicking back to the search box. If a web page has a low dwell time, it means the user did not find the page useful. Thus, it is a part of the machine learning algorithm of a search engine but not the only deciding factor for ranking a page.

Q54. What is the role of Google Analytics?

Google Analytics is a web analytic tool to know the performance of your website. It provides statistics support to optimize your website for search engines. Thus, helps you achieve better in terms of conversion.
